What You’ll Do:
As a Fire Sprinkler Apprentice, you’ll gain hands-on experience while working alongside industry experts. Your responsibilities will include:
- Installing, repairing, and maintaining fire sprinkler systems.
- Inspecting systems to ensure safety and compliance.
- Reading and following plans and blueprints.
- Handling and transporting pipes and materials.
- Following MSHA and OSHA safety regulations.
- Completing training and coursework through the AFSA Apprenticeship Program.
- Working 8, 10, or 12-hour shifts, with occasional on-call duty and overnight travel.
